What advanced function characteristics are covered in 11th grade?

In 11th grade, often in Pre-Calculus or Algebra 2, analysis extends to more complex functions. Key topics include identifying vertical, horizontal, and slant asymptotes in rational functions, understanding domain restrictions in radical and logarithmic functions, and analyzing the periodic nature and amplitude of trigonometric functions.

What is a good strategy for teaching asymptotes and discontinuities?

Before introducing the algebraic rules, have students explore a rational function's behavior using a table of values. Ask them to input x-values that get closer and closer to the point of discontinuity. This helps them build an intuitive understanding of a limit and see why the graph approaches the asymptote without touching it.

What are common errors in 11th-grade function analysis?

A frequent mistake with rational functions is confusing a hole (a removable discontinuity) with a vertical asymptote. When working with logarithmic functions, students often forget that the argument must be strictly positive, leading to incorrect domain calculations.

How does this topic prepare students for calculus?

This topic is a direct and essential prerequisite for calculus. A deep understanding of function behavior, particularly concepts like continuity, end behavior, and asymptotes, is fundamental to learning about limits. Mastering the analysis of rational, logarithmic, and trigonometric functions in 11th grade provides the necessary foundation for studying derivatives and integrals.

What types of problems are on an 11th-grade function characteristics quiz?

Problems at this level require students to perform multi-step analysis. This includes finding all asymptotes from a rational function's equation, determining the domain and range of composite functions, and identifying the period and amplitude of a transformed sine or cosine graph.
